Masonry Scaffolding for Sale A Comprehensive Overview for Exporters


Masonry scaffolding is a critical component in the construction industry, specifically designed to provide support and access during masonry work. As the demand for efficient and safe construction practices continues to rise globally, the market for masonry scaffolding has expanded significantly. For exporters, understanding the intricacies of this niche can pave the way for successful international trade.


The Importance of Masonry Scaffolding


Masonry scaffolding serves several essential functions it not only provides a safe working platform for laborers but also ensures that materials are efficiently handled at varying heights. This type of scaffolding is particularly valuable for brick, stone, and block work, making it an indispensable tool in both residential and commercial construction projects.


One of the primary advantages of masonry scaffolding is its adaptability. It can be customized to fit different building structures and heights, accommodating the specific needs of various projects. Exporters should note that offering versatile scaffolding solutions can significantly enhance their appeal in the marketplace.


Key Features Exporters Should Highlight


When marketing masonry scaffolding, exporters should emphasize several key features to attract potential buyers


1. Durability Scaffolding must withstand heavy weights and harsh working conditions. Highlighting the material quality, such as the use of heavy-duty steel or aluminum, can assure buyers of long-lasting performance.

2. Safety Compliance Safety regulations for scaffolding are stringent worldwide. Exporters should ensure their products comply with international safety standards, such as those set by OSHA (Occupational Safety and Health Administration) or other relevant bodies. Providing certification and safety features can boost buyer confidence.


3. Ease of Assembly Quick and efficient assembly is a considerable selling point. Exporters should focus on designs that facilitate easy setup and takedown, thus saving time and labor costs.


4. Cost-Effectiveness Offering competitive pricing without compromising on quality can make a significant difference. Exporters should conduct market research to understand pricing trends and position their products accordingly.


Target Markets for Exporters


The global market for masonry scaffolding is diverse, with opportunities in both developed and emerging economies. Experienced exporters should consider targeting regions with booming construction industries, such as Asia-Pacific, the Middle East, and parts of Africa. Understanding local regulations and cultural practices is crucial for a successful entry into these markets.


Additionally, building relationships with local construction firms and procurement agencies can facilitate smoother transactions and open doors for repeat business.
